Output 2aaf23c66b4e04e2114f0d05c85199ae0da428f7e9ff95787354d0a9ef74ff16:1

value
629281
script pubkey
OP_0 OP_PUSHBYTES_20 391df63625940064033a3569f7f3482c596e10c3
address
bc1q8ywlvd39jsqxgqe6x45l0u6g93vkuyxrs89upn
transaction
2aaf23c66b4e04e2114f0d05c85199ae0da428f7e9ff95787354d0a9ef74ff16
spent
true